Premier League preview: Chelsea vs Spurs

Premier League preview: Chelsea vs Spurs

Chelsea might have suffered an eye-catching loss away to Arsenal a few weeks ago. But playing at Stamford Bridge, Mauricio Pochettino’s side have looked pretty dependable in recent weeks.

The Blues have won five of their last six home games in all competitions; their last game at the Bridge saw the hosts triumph 6-0 over Everton.

Admittedly, much of the good feeling that result generated may have faded in the wake of that 5-0 defeat to the Gunners a week later.

But the west London side showed improvement in the 2-2 draw against Aston Villa last week. And playing at home against his old club, Pochettino will demand another committed performance on Thursday night.

When the two sides met at the Tottenham stadium in November, Chelsea won 4-1 as Nicolas Jackson racked up a hat-trick. Ange Postecoglou would surely like to atone for that result here, but Spurs aren’t currently in the most intimidating form.

Tottenham lost 4-0 to Newcastle in their last away game, having shipped three goals away to Fulham at Craven Cottage back in March. They were also beaten at the weekend, losing 3-2 at home to Arsenal.

The hosts look a pretty good shout to uphold their excellent record against Spurs, then; the Blues have lost just one of their last 33 home league games against the north London club.
